Output fd65e0e868240b3041139005569fc8976877573141b0195b217c132a83e266cf:0

value
4023732
script pubkey
OP_0 OP_PUSHBYTES_20 0f8d3f4473d730fe9a7b62145d46f9bb8aff725b
address
bc1qp7xn73rn6uc0axnmvg2963hehw907ujm8dgfh9
transaction
fd65e0e868240b3041139005569fc8976877573141b0195b217c132a83e266cf
confirmations
270659
spent
true